安装cocos2d 2.0 XCode模板

5
我正在尝试安装cocos2d 2.0 XCode 4模板,但运行安装脚本时一直出错。我已经尝试手动复制模板,但是当我尝试编译我的项目时,它给了我很多错误。有人可以帮忙吗?
以下是安装脚本抛出的错误:

http://pastebin.com/ZdmAxwef

任何帮助都非常感激! 谢谢!

也遇到了这个问题...找不到解决方案。这个脚本也无法在sudo下运行。 - Accatyyc
1
我为了让它正常工作所做的是,我删除了安装脚本中不允许您以root身份运行的部分。然后我以root身份运行了脚本,一切都成功复制了。构建并运行项目,没有错误 :) - Null
4个回答

4

您可能以root用户身份安装了cocos2d 1.x模板。由于不再支持以root身份安装,因此您需要首先将它们的所有权更改为您的用户。


3

我按照以下步骤操作:

cd /src/cocos2d-iphone-2.0/

./install-templates.sh -f

这个教程是在http://www.cocos2d-iphone.org/wiki/doku.php/prog_guide:migrate_to_v2.0找到的。

另外,我在我的Mac硬盘“Macintosh HD”上创建了一个名为“src”的文件夹,并将cocos2d-iphone-2.0文件夹复制到其中。我使用的是Mountain Lion和Xcode 4.4,这个方法完美地解决了我的问题。

希望这能帮到您。


我已经让那一部分工作了,但是我该如何在Xcode中使用它呢?我尝试了#import "cocos2d.h",但似乎找不到它... - jowie

3

有三件事情可以尝试:

首先,请确保您以sudo身份运行install-templates.sh

cd *location of cocos2d-2.0 folder*
sudo ./install-templates.sh -u -f
where -f forces the installation

第二,您可能需要更改install-templates.sh脚本以安装到不同的位置(尝试使用您的用户和直接到Machintosh HD)。
第三,(这是我过去经常做的)是将文件夹复制到正确的目录中(或者至少使目录在mkdir失败并重试)。

它一直告诉我 'root' 不再受支持。我还不断收到 rsync 错误。 - Null
2
在第二行的sudo后面替换为:./install-templates.sh -f - SimplyKiwi
即使在末尾加上-f,sudo也无法工作。我刚刚把sudo从前面去掉了,然后就成功安装了,没有出现任何错误。现在我需要找出如何将其导入到Xcode项目中! - jowie
我也是,只用"./install-templates.sh -u -f"就行了。 - Ramy Al Zuhouri

0

这是许多年前的事了

  • 解决方案现在很简单,你不再需要做任何事情了。

只需从以下网址安装最新版本的Cocos2D:

cocos2d-swift.org

它会自动安装所有内容,包括模板。只需启动一个新的Xcode项目,就可以在模板选项中找到它。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接